The film Chila NewGen Nattuvisheshangal is a romantic drama directed by East Coast Vijayan.
The film's narrative revolves around the protagonist's endeavours to win over her romantic interest. He aspired to enhance his financial standing in the eyes of his prospective father-in-law. He attempted a multitude of business ventures but was ultimately unsuccessful. Consequently, he agreed to marry a woman on behalf of a wealthy elderly man who was in a state of semi-consciousness. Upon the marriage, he would become the owner of the aforementioned man's wealth. However, their plans were thwarted after marriage when the elderly man regained consciousness and returned to a state of full health. Subsequently, his actual lover and father-in-law became aware of his new relationship, leading to its dissolution.
The narrative is outdated and unproductive, which detracts from the overall quality of the film. The storytelling approach is uninspiring, and the acting performances are lacklustre, particularly given the calibre of the cast. The musical numbers, however, are a notable highlight.

A decently crafted movie with lots of fun filled moments. Songs in the movie stand apart. Suraj Venjarammud and Hareesh Kanaran have played their characters with ease and extremely well. The film, apart from a lot of new faces, also has a line up of talented artists like Nedumudu Venu, Dinesh Panicker, Nobi, Bijukuttan etc. All together it is a good movie to be enjoyed with your family and friends.
